VAPAHCS Human Blood and Blood Related Products Questions and Answers 36C26126Q0165 QUESTION: I noticed that the volumes suggest the Palo Alto VA uses 1400 Autologous RBCs. Can you help me understand why? Typically, we do not see this many autologous units given at any of the hospitals we currently service, so I m curious to understand the reasoning or patient population(s) that are requiring autologous RBCs. ANSWER: 1400 is a typo. On our last contract we indicated 15 units- see chart below. We rarely get autologous RBCs. We had 2 between 8/2024 and 8/2025. The 1400 has been corrected Please see updated Price List (36C26126DXXXX_PRICE LIST_V2). QUESTION: There is a small, steady number of HLA-specific products and testing. Can you share with me the types of patient populations that are being treated and need this type of testing (i.e, Transplant, oncology, etc.)? ANSWER: The majority of these orders come from the Transplant/Cardiology Department. QUESTION: The response date is January 19th, 2026. Background
The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) is issuing this solicitation for the procurement of human blood and blood-related products for the VA Palo Alto Health Care System (VAPAHCS). The mission of the VA is to provide high-quality healthcare services to veterans. This contract aims to ensure a reliable supply of safe and compliant blood products, adhering to all relevant FDA guidelines and regulations.

Work Details
The contractor shall provide human blood, blood components, and related services as specified in the solicitation. Key details include:
- **Ordering Period 1**: 06/01/2026 – 09/30/2026
- **Ordering Period 2**: 10/01/2026 – 09/30/2027
- **Ordering Period 3**: 10/01/2027 – 09/30/2028
- **Ordering Period 4**: 10/01/2028 – 09/30/2029
- **Ordering Period 5**: 10/01/2029 – 09/30/2030
- The contractor must comply with FDA guidelines for blood collection, including testing for syphilis, HIV, hepatitis B and C, and other pathogens.
- Blood products must be labeled as A, B, O, and Rh type with specific expiration dates based on collection methods. For example:
- Red blood cell products must not exceed 15 days from the date of collection.
- Whole blood has varying shelf lives depending on the anticoagulant used (CPD: 21 days; CPDA-1: 35 days; ADSOL: 42 days).
- All procedures must conform to aseptic conditions and appropriate labeling requirements.

Period of Performance
The estimated period of performance spans from June 1, 2026, to September 30, 2030, with multiple ordering periods specified within this timeframe.
